Tigers Den is a unique restaurant nestled inside White Tiger bar in Austin, offering an elevated culinary experience with a focus on Asian-inspired bar food. We serve fresh, flavorful dishes like crab rangoon, fried rice, and General Tso's in a cool, intimate atmosphere with an outdoor patio. Perfect for casual dining, happy hour, or late-night bites, we combine great food with friendly service and live music on select nights.

I never write bad reviews, but this one was impossible to ignore. I came in around 12 AM (they’re open until 1 AM), just wanting some healthy munchies, and the whole order was a letdown. I ordered edamame, miso soup, and two mango sticky rices for me and my girlfriend. First, the mango sticky rice was overcooked and dry—some pieces were even crispy from being burnt. The miso soup was cold, which was such a disappointment. And the edamame? Some pieces were nicely charred, but a lot of them were over-charred and burnt, to the point where the skin would flake off in my mouth. Super unpleasant. It just feels like they don’t really prioritize quality across all their menu items, which is frustrating—especially when I paid $25 and still tipped. Definitely hoping for a better experience next time, but this visit really missed the mark.
A bar with a ballin restaurant attached. I was a bit confused by the website, but the food looked amazing so I had to see what was up. The bar and restaurant are separate businesses. The bartender was great and I got a drink while I ordered food. You can eat in or take to-go. There is an outdoor patio as well that's dog friendly. I got a drink, crab rangoon and fried rice. Ended up taking half the food home because it was a good size portion. The crab rangoon was Amazing. The rice was good too, but the rangoon stole the show. Great spot with friendly staff.
We wanted to try this newer restaurant due to the promise of Asian style bar food and wasn’t disappointed! We went on a Wednesday evening as a sort of happy hour like dinner and there was live music - she did a great job! Crab Rangoon and fried rice…definitely a MUST. We got the meat sweats fried rice and was some of the best I’ve had! General Tsos was ok, as were the Dr Pepper wings. The miso soup was good, as were the little fried things with the lemony aioli. I did not like the duck dumplings at all (and I love duck and dumplings). My partner still enjoyed them. Also, we had a lot of leftovers! Which isn’t a bad thing haha! Good portion sizes overall. We will definitely be back!
